Как работает мультиплексор

Как работает мультиплексор.

Теперь, когда мы знаем где применяется мультиплексор, давайте рассмотрим чем он отличается от переключателя.

Первое, современные мультиплексоры строятся по КМОП технологии и как следствие открытый канал имеет некоторое сопротивление, величина этого сопротивления может быть меньше 1 Ома и зависит от величины питающего напряжения. Сопротивление канала можно узнать из даташита, обозначается оно Ron.

Второе, напряжение, которое может коммутировать мультиплексор, а также напряжение на управляющих входах не должно превышать напряжение питания. Максимальный ток коммутации современных мультиплексоров может достигать 400mA. Опять же максимальный ток можно узнать из даташита, в разных даташитах оно обозначается по разному.

Третье, так как мультиплексор построен по КМОП технологии в его структуре присутствуют ёмкости, которые ухудшают его характеристики. Эквивалентная схема двухканального мультиплексора выглядит следующим образом.

  • На картинке видно, что между каналами есть некоторая ёмкость Css и Cdd, по которой сигнал с одного канала может проникать в другой.
  • Наличие ёмкости Cds, приводит к тому, что на высоких частотах сигнал проходит через разомкнутый ключ.
  • Сопротивление Ron вместе с ёмкостью Сd, образуют фильтр нижних частот, который ограничивает полосу пропускания.

Также на эквивалентной схеме изображены источники тока, которые отражают ток утечки, который в свою очередь, может является источником ошибки.

Пятое, переключение не происходит мгновенно, для того чтобы ключ открылся/закрылся необходимо некоторое время, которое определяется временем перезаряда ёмкости затвор-канал.

Digitrode

цифровая электроника вычислительная техника встраиваемые системы

Мультиплексоры и демультиплексоры: принцип работы, объяснение на простом примере, применение

Мультиплексоры и демультиплексоры (mux и demux в англоязычном сокращении) представляют собой довольно распространенные компоненты в цифровой электронике. Понимание происходящих в них логических процессов позволят лучше понимать схемы с их участием и разрабатывать более сложные электронные устройства

Мультиплексоры и демультиплексоры работают противоположно друг другу, но в соответствии с одним и тем же принципом. Они состоят из информационных входов, информационных выходов и коммутатора (селектора).

На изображении ниже схематично представлены мультиплексор и демультиплексор.

Мультиплексор имеет несколько информационных входов. Коммутатор мультиплексора выбирает, какой из этих входов нужно использовать и подключает его к информационному выходу, который у мультиплексора только один. Эту ситуацию можно сравнить с тем, если бы вам куча людей хотела бы сказать что-то свое, но за один раз вы можете выслушать только одного.

Читайте также:  Является ли газовая котельная опасным производственным объектом

Демультиплексор, наоборот, имеет только один информационный вход, и коммутатор подключает его к какому-то одному информационному выходу в каждый момент времени. То есть, это так же, как если бы вы хотели сказать что-то толпе людей, но за каждый момент времени вы можете сказать это только одному человеку из этой толпы.

Существуют также микросхемы, которые объединяют в себе функции мультиплексоров и демультиплексоров. В англоязычном варианте они обычно обозначаются mux/demux. Также они могут называться двунаправленными мультиплексорами или же просто коммутаторами. Они позволяют сигналу передаваться в обоих направлениях. Так что не только вы можете поговорить с кем-то, но и кто-то из толпы может поговорить с вами в определенный момент времени.

К внутреннему коммутатору в данном случае обычно подходят несколько информационных входов, которые адресуются в двоичной форме. Практически во всех таких микросхемах есть линия OE (output enable или выход активен). Также внутри микросхемы имеется демультиплексор с одним входом и, обычно, с четырьмя выходами. Для выбора выхода у микросхемы имеются также две линии для адресации выхода (00, 01, 10, 11).

Существуют как цифровые, так и аналоговые мультиплексоры. Цифровые представляют собой логические коммутаторы, у которых на выходе будет то же напряжение, что и напряжение питания. Аналоговые же подключают к выходу напряжение выбранного входа.

Принцип мультиплексирования и демультиплексирования использовали на заре развития телефонии в начале прошлого века. Тогда человек, который хотел позвонить своему товарищу, брал телефонную трубку и ждал ответа оператора. Это мультиплексорная часть, поскольку в определенный момент времени оператор из множества выбирает линию, на которой «сидит» этот человек. Человек сообщает, что хочет поговорить с товарищем, номер которого 12345. Это уже коммутаторная часть, здесь оператор получает номер (адрес). Далее он подключает разъем, к каналу товарища. Это демультиплексорная часть. Здесь одна линия из множества каналов соединяется только с одним.

Мультиплексоры и демультиплексоры помогут вам решить задачу с расширением количества входных или выходных линий, если число GPIO вашего микроконтроллера слишком мало. Если у вас в проекте предусмотрено много датчиков, то вы можете подключить их к мультиплексору. Выход мультиплексора затем нужно подключить к АЦП и переключая адреса линий последовательно считывать данные с датчиков.

Также мультиплексоры полезны, когда у вас есть несколько микросхем с интерфейсом I2C, которые имеют одинаковый адрес. Просто подключите линии SDA/SCL к коммутатору и управляйте ими последовательно. Мультиплексоры и демультиплексоры можно задействовать еще и в качестве преобразователей уровней.

Таким образом, эти устройства представляют собой большую ценность для цифровой электроники. Их правильное применение может значительно упростить проект.

Мультиплексоры и демультиплексоры

3.7. Мультиплексоры и демультиплексоры

Мультиплексор – это устройство, которое осуществляет выборку одного из нескольких входов и подключает его к своему единственному выходу, в зависимости от состояния двоичного кода. Другими словами, мультиплексор – переключатель сигналов, управляемый двоичным кодом и имеющий несколько входов и один выход. К выходу подключается тот вход, чей номер соответствует управляющему двоичному коду.

Читайте также:  Как включиться в самоспасатель

Ну и частное определение: мультиплексор – это устройство, преобразующее параллельный код в последовательный.

Структуру мультиплексора можно представить различными схемами, например, вот этой:

Рис. 1 – Пример схемы конкретного мультиплексора

Самый большой элемент здесь это элемент И-ИЛИ на четыре входа. Квадратики с единичками – инверторы.

Разберем выводы. Те, что слева, а именно D0-D3, называются информационными входами. На них подают информацию, которую предстоит выбрать. Входы А0-А1 называются адресными входами. Сюда и подается двоичный код, от которого зависит, какой из входов D0-D3 будет подключен к выходу, на этой схеме обозначенному как Y. Вход С – синхронизация, разрешение работы.

На схеме еще есть входы адреса с инверсией. Это чтобы сделать устройство более универсальным.

На рисунке показан, как еще его называют, 4Х1 мультиплексор. Как мы знаем, что число разных двоичных чисел, которые может задавать код, определяется числом разрядов кода как 2 n , где n – число разрядов. Задавать нужно 4 состояния мультиплексора, а, значит, разрядов в коде адреса должно быть 2 (2 2 = 4).

Для пояснения принципа работы этой схемы посмотрим на её таблицу истинности:

Так двоичный код выбирает нужный вход. Например, имеем четыре объекта, и они подают сигналы, а устройство отображения у нас одно. Берем мультиплексор. В зависимости от двоичного кода к устройству отображения подключается сигнал от нужного объекта.

Микросхемой мультиплексор обозначается так:

Рис. 2 – Мультиплексор как МКС

Демультиплексор – устройство, обратное мультиплексору. Т. е., у демультиплексора один вход и много выходов. Двоичный код определяет, какой выход будет подключен ко входу.

Другими словами, демультиплексор – это устройство, которое осуществляет выборку одного из нескольких своих выходов и подключает его к своему входу или, ещё, это переключатель сигналов, управляемый двоичным кодом и имеющий один вход и несколько выходов.

Ко входу подключается тот выход, чей номер соответствует состоянию двоичного кода. И частное определение: демультиплексор – это устройство, которое преобразует последовательный код в параллельный.

Обычно в качестве демультиплексора используют дешифраторы двоичного кода в позиционный, в которых вводят дополнительный вход стробирования.

Из-за сходства схем мультиплексора и демультиплексора в КМОП сериях есть микросхемы, которые одновременно являются мультиплексором и демультиплексором, смотря с какой стороны подавать сигналы.

Например, К561КП1, работающая как переключатель 8х1 и переключатель 1х8 (то есть, как мультиплексор и демультиплексор с восемью входами или выходами). Кроме того, в КМОП микросхемах помимо переключения цифровых сигналов (логических 0 или 1) существует возможность переключения аналоговых.

Другими словами, это переключатель аналоговых сигналов, управляемый цифровым кодом. Такие микросхемы называются коммутаторами. К примеру, с помощью коммутатора можно переключать сигналы, поступающие на вход усилителя (селектор входов). Рассмотрим схему селектора входов УМЗЧ. Построим её с использованием триггеров и мультиплексора.

Читайте также:  Как включить звук на сигнализации пандора

Рис. 3 – Селектор входных сигналов

Итак, разберем работу. На триггерах микросхемы DD1 собран кольцевой счетчик нажатий кнопки разрядностью 2 (два триггера – 2 разряда). Двухразрядный двоичный код поступает на адресные входы D0-D1 микросхемы DD2. Микросхема DD2 представляет собой сдвоенный четырехканальный коммутатор.

В соответствии с двоичным кодом к выходам микросхемы А и В подключаются входы А0-А3 и В0-В3 соответственно. Элементы R1, R2, C1 устраняют дребезг контактов кнопки.

Дифференцирующая цепь R3C2 устанавливает триггеры в нулевое состояние при включении питания, при этом к выходу подключается первый вход. При нажатии на кнопку триггер DD1.1 переключается в состояние лог. 1 и к выходу подключается второй вход и т. д. Перебор входов идет по кольцу, начиная с первого.

С одной стороны просто, с другой немного неудобно. Кто его знает, сколько раз нажали на кнопку после включения и какой вход подключен к выходу сейчас. Хорошо бы поставить индикатор подключенного входа.

Вспоминаем семисегментный дешифратор. Переносим дешифратор с индикатором на схему коммутатора и первые два входа дешифратора (на схеме обозначен как DD3), т. е. 1 и 2 (выводы 7 и 1) подключаем к прямым выходам триггеров DD1.1 DD1.2 (выводы 1 и 13). Входы дешифратора 4 и 8 (выводы 2 и 6) соединяем с корпусом (т. е. подаем лог. 0). Индикатор будет показывать состояние кольцевого счетчика, а именно цифры от 0 до 3. Цифра 0 соответствует первому входу, 1 – 2-му и т. д.

Рекомендую самостоятельно составить новую схему селектора.

Мультиплексоры: виды, сферы применения и особенности

Мультиплексоры – это специальные сетевые устройства, которые предназначаются для передачи различных потоков информации с большой скоростью. При передаче используется единичная линия связи. Передаваемый поток информации должен обладать маленькой скоростью.

Использование мультиплексоров – актуальная, быстрая и экономная мера. Их применение позволяет отказаться от создания нового канала связи, передающего информацию, независимо проводного или беспроводного.

Особенные черты мультиплексоров

Некоторые моменты влияют на строение мультиплексоров:

1. Количество компонентов, которые являются доступными.
2. Какая технология была применена при создании мультиплексора.
3. Конфигурация мультиплексора. Этот фактор зависит от того, какие задачи будут ставиться перед мультиплексором.

Большой популярностью пользуются модульные мультиплексоры. Это современные конструкции приборов, имеющие некоторое количество сменных модулей. При помощи таких сменных модулей обеспечена возможность, которая позволит изменить конфигурацию мультиплексора, в соответствии с требованиями пользователя и условиями использования.

Работа мультиплексора во многом схожа с работой коммутаторов, обеспечивающих возможность подключения нескольких входов и выхода. Такое сетевое оборудование приводится в действие с помощью двух типов входа. По одному разрешающему и управляющему входу.

На видео: Принцип работы мультиплексора.